1. The feed(solvent) goes into MSS (membrane separation skid) at ambient temperature and pressure.

2. After being pressurized by feed pump, heated by heat-exchanger and steam Heater, the feed enters the first membrane to dehydrate. In the course of dehydration, the liquid water is vaporized and solvent temperature drops. Then after re-heated by Inter-heater, the solvent maintains initial temperature and enters the second membrane for continuous dehydration.

3. By a number of repetitive dehydrations and passing through the heat-exchanger, after-cooler and relief valve, pure solvent at ambient temperature and pressure is attained.
